前端學習計劃

前端學習計劃

推薦學習網站

菜鳥教程: http://www.runoob.comcss

W3cschool:http://www.w3cschool.cn前端

慕課:http://www.imooc.comnode

麥子學院:http://www.maiziedu.comgit

框架和工具

BootStrap:http://v4.bootcss.comgithub

Materialize:http://materializecss.com編程

Font Awesome:http://www.fontawesome.com.cn後端

Material Icons:http://google.github.io/material-design-icons/sass

Datatables:http://datatables.club服務器

Bootstrap-fileinput:http://plugins.krajee.com/file-input框架

Layer:http://layer.layui.com

BootCDN:http://www.bootcdn.cn

Electron:http://electron.atom.io

Electron中文文檔:http://www.kancloud.cn/wizardforcel/electron-doc/137761

Node.js:http://nodejs.cn

Sass文檔:http://www.w3cplus.com/sassguide/

Animate.css:http://daneden.me/animate

1、 第一階段(基礎)

1.     HTML+CSS3學習,靜態頁面。主要是頁面設計,還有一些頁面佈局和排版,例如:聖盃佈局、雙飛翼佈局;瞭解SEO優化。

2.     HTML DOM學習,結合JavaScript

3.     JavaScript學習,重要。這個不學好基本前端就僅僅是前端了。

4.     Jquery學習,開發效率高,功能強大。

 

2、 第二階段(掌握)

1.     BootStrap學習,開發效率極高的框架,主要是目前響應式很流行。

2.     Materialize學習,可選,相似BootStrap的Material design設計框架,同響應式。

3.     Font Awesome和Material Icons學習,簡單的統一圖標,Font Awesome兼容性更好。

4.     Animate.css學習,簡單的動畫

5.     Datatables學習,可選,強大的Table(表格)框架。

6.     Bootstrap-fileinput學習,可選,Bootstrap的文件框擴展,功能強大。

7.     Layer學習,功能強大的彈窗。

3、 第三階段(進階)

1.     Node.js,必學。能夠理解爲後端,由於是JavaScript語言,能夠作應用以及服務器,之後可能MVC的模式改變就是由於它。不少大型公司讓前端人員寫Controller。

2.     Sass學習。更好的管理CSS樣式,更適合編程習慣。

 

4、 第四階段(綜合)

1.     Electron學習,使用前端和Node.js開發跨平臺桌面應用。

2.     前端開發移動端App

 

5、 其餘

待補充

 

                                                                                                                                                               內容提供者:薛龍

相關文章
相關標籤/搜索